 Method of regulating warp yarn tension in a weaving machine

A method of regulating the tension of warp yarns in a weaving machine is disclosed herein. In a preferred embodiment of the invention, variation in warp yarn tension is detected by a tension roller which is movable with a change in the tension. The speed at which a warp beam is rotated is controlled in dependence upon the manner of the tension roller movement in such a way that its unwinding rotation during normal weaving operation of the machine is speeded up with an increase in the warp yarn tension and slowed down with a decrease therein, and also that its rewinding rotation during reversing operation of the machine is decelerated with an increase in the warp yarn tension and accelerated with a decrease in the tension.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ION It is an object of the present invention, therefore, to provide a method of warp yarn regulating in a weaving machine, the use of which can prevent formation of fabric defects such as weaving bar as are produced by irregular warp yarn tension due to reversed operation of the loom.
It is another object of the invention to provide a method of warp yarn regulating which can permit restarting of the loom with no troublesome procedure associated with adjustment of the rate at which the warp yarns are delivered from a warp beam and of the cloth fell position.
In an embodiment of the method according to the invention contemplated to achieve the above objects, variation of warp yarn tension from a reference value corresponding to an optimum tension is detected by a tension roller which is movable with a change in the tension, and the rate at which the warp yarns are unwound from the warp beam is controlled by a speed reducer whose variable speed reduction ratio is adjusted depending upon the extent and direction of the movement of the tension roller; i.
e.
, said rate is controlled in such a way that it is decelerated with a decrease of the warp yarn tension or accelerated with an increase thereof so that the warp yarns are regulated properly within a permissible range of tension.
When the loom is operated in its reverse direction and the warp beam is also reversed to rewind the warp yarns thereon, however, controlling of the rate at which the warp yarns are rewound on the warp beam is made in an opposite way as compared with the controlling of the rate of unwinding in the above-mentioned normal forward operation of the weaving machine, i.
e.
, the rate of rewinding is decelerated with an increase of the warp yarn tension while it is accelerated with a decrease thereof so that the warp yarn tension may be regulated properly during the reversing rotation of the loom.
